Paralegal / Legal Assistant (New Orleans)

Metairie, United States

The Paralegal / Legal Assistant assists the assigned attorney in all aspects of case management, from case inception to settlement or trial. Will assist attorney by providing clerical and research support services including document preparation and review; interviewing clients and witnesses; research, investigations, and fact checking; and trial preparation. It is expressly understood and practiced that all duties associated with this position are performed under the direct supervision of the assigned attorney.

Job Duties
  • Maintain client communication on a regular basis.
  • Gather and analyze intake information, as well as relevant documents associated with new files and enter pertinent information into case management software.
  • Initiate claims, verify coverage and maintain communication with insurance adjusters to provide case status updates.
  • Prepare documents and correspondence such as letters of representation, demand letters, billing inquiries, etc.
  • Collect documentation of all damages sustained such as medical records, bills and loss of wages.
  • Update case details on a regular basis
  • Assists in drafting legal documents including routine pleadings and motions
  • Prepares, organizes, stores, and retrieves case files.
  • Assists attorneys with trial preparation, which may include attending trials and hearings.
  • Maintains Attorney calendar
  • Experience as a legal assistant required
  • Knowledge of federal court process / language
  • Experience drafting discovery a plus
  • Ability to work high volume and remain detail oriented
  • Experience calendaring for a supervisor/attorney
